Enable job alerts via email!

Senior Back-End Engineer

Yassir

United States

Remote

USD 90,000 - 130,000

Full time

5 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Join Yassir as a Back-end developer and be part of a transformative tech journey in the Maghreb region. Work with cutting-edge technologies to build robust backend systems and contribute to a rapidly growing startup that provides impactful financial and on-demand services to millions. Enjoy attractive compensation, a stake in the company, and the chance to make a real difference in the digital economy.

Benefits

Attractive salary with stake in the company
Subsidized public transit pass
Opportunities for personal growth
Make a significant impact in the community
Steep learning curve with guidance

Qualifications

  • At least four years of experience in a similar role.
  • Solid knowledge of OOP and software design.
  • Experience working in fast-paced environments.

Responsibilities

  • Build robust and scalable software in Node.js, Python, or Go.
  • Design and create microservices and system architectures.
  • Improve existing code quality via unit tests and automation.

Skills

OOP knowledge
Software design
Node.js
Python
Go
REST APIs
Micro-services
Version control (GIT)

Education

BSc/MSc in Engineering
Computer Science

Tools

Express.js
MongoDB
Docker
Kubernetes
Redis

Job description

Yassir is the leading super App in the Maghreb region set to changing the way daily services are provided. It currently operates in 45 cities across Algeria, Morocco and Tunisia with recent expansions into France, Canada and Sub-Saharan Africa. It is backed (~$200M in funding) by VCs from Silicon Valley, Europe and other parts of the world.

We offer on-demand services such as ride-hailing and last-mile delivery. Building on this infrastructure, we are now introducing financial services to help our users pay, save and borrow digitally.

Helping usher the continent into a digital economy era. We’re not just about serving people - we’re about creating a marketplace to bring people what they need while infusing social values.

About the role

In this role, you will be part of our growing and international engineering team, working with a high-quality code base and the latest tools, where you will promote your skills to be an expert in complex backend development, including microservices architecture, using Node.js. You will own and build large scale backend systems and micro-services. You will design, develop, and deliver powerful server-side applications in a highly dynamic environment, where root cause analysis and rapid problem-solving are required.


About your role as “Back-end developer”
  • Build robust and scalable software in Node js, Python or Go
  • Design and create (micro)services and system architecture for projects, and contribute and provide feedback to other team members
  • Help improve existing code quality through writing unit tests, automation and performing code reviews
  • Participate in brainstorming sessions and contribute ideas to our technology, algorithms and products
  • Work with the engineering and design teams to understand end-user requirements, formulate use cases, and then translate that into a pragmatic and effective technical solution
  • Dive into difficult problems and successfully deliver results on schedule
About your experience
  • At least four years of experience in a similar role
  • Solid OOP and software design knowledge – you should know how to create software that is extensible, reusable and meets desired architectural objectives
Must have technical skills:
  • Language: Node.Js.
  • Database: Mongodb or other.
  • Framework: Express.js or other.
  • Web architecture: Rest and restful APIs, micro-services
  • Master source version control: GIT
Nice to have technical skills (Strongly advised for senior profiles):
  • Containers: Docker, kubernetes
  • Caching, Redis server
  • Demonstrated ability to prioritize, self-start, contribute under pressure and meet tight deadlines
  • Highly organized, creative and critical thinker
  • Comfortable working in an entrepreneurial environment
  • Experience in a rapidly growing company in the mobility, on-demand or fintech space is a plus
  • BSc/MSc in Engineering, Computer Science or relevant field
Why you should join Yassir
  • You will be part of one of the first Algerian startups to go through the Y Combinator program and one of the fastest-growing tech companies in North Africa. We are current in +30 cities (Algeria, Tunisia, Morocco, Senegal, France and Germany)
  • Attractive salary and you even get a stake in the company
  • Subsidized public transit pass
  • Have a lasting impact on our company's culture
  • Perfect timing with renowned investors to build something great
  • Extremely steep learning curve with own responsibility and intensive guidance
  • Make a real impact on the world by helping us bring affordable financial and on-demand services to millions of Africans

At Yassir, we believe in the power of diversity and the importance of an inclusive culture. So, if you're ready to bring your unique perspective and experiences to the table, then we're excited to listen.

Don't just apply for a job, come and be a part of our journey. Let's create a better tomorrow together.

We look forward to receiving your application!

Best of luck,

Your Yassir TA Team

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Senior Software Engineer

Podium Education

Remote

USD 70.000 - 100.000

2 days ago
Be an early applicant

Senior Fullstack Developer

Siecompany

Remote

USD 123.000 - 148.000

7 days ago
Be an early applicant

Senior Software Engineer II, Backend

LTK

Remote

USD 100.000 - 900.000

3 days ago
Be an early applicant

Senior Backend Engineer

wordly, Inc

Remote

USD 120.000 - 180.000

10 days ago

Senior Backend Engineer

Yendo

Remote

USD 100.000 - 150.000

8 days ago

Senior Backend Engineer

Dispel

Remote

USD 100.000 - 900.000

10 days ago

Senior Software Engineer

The Planet Group

Remote

USD 110.000 - 120.000

3 days ago
Be an early applicant

Senior Software Developer (Generative AI & LLM expertise)

TechStar Group

Remote

USD 110.000 - 130.000

3 days ago
Be an early applicant

Remote Senior Software Engineer (LLM) - 34953

Turing

Remote

USD 70.000 - 100.000

2 days ago
Be an early applicant